
This is a good pink form of a Californian native vetch. In the wild a potentially vigorous coloniser but here I've found it no more so than some of the popular climbing Lathyrus such as L.latifolius, and it makes a very nice change from that with its fresh green pinnate foliage and spikes of rich pink flowers.

Even so I'd give it plenty of space somewhere it won't swamp small treasures. Spring flowering - cut it back to the ground after flowering for fresh new growth.
